How the Concept Works
Spin casinos operate on a simple yet engaging principle. Users access the online platform through their device (computer, smartphone, tablet), deposit funds using various payment methods, and then select games to play. The outcome of each game is determined by algorithms, ensuring fairness and randomness.
Games are categorized into different types, such as slots, table games (poker, blackjack, roulette), or specialty games (bingo, keno). Each type offers unique gameplay mechanics and rules, but the underlying concept remains consistent: users place bets, spin reels, roll dice, or draw cards in hopes of winning.
Legal or Regional Context
Regulatory frameworks governing online gaming vary across jurisdictions. Some countries have laws explicitly allowing or prohibiting online casino activities, while others lack clear guidelines. Players must familiarize themselves with local regulations before participating in online gaming activities.
Regional differences also influence the types of games available on spin casinos. For example, some platforms may offer specific titles catering to Asian markets (e.g., Mahjong) or European preferences (e.g., slot machines based on popular movies).
Free Play, Demo Modes, or Non-Monetary Options
Many spin casino operators provide options for users to play without wagering real money. This feature allows new players to get accustomed to the platform and games before committing funds.
- Demo modes : Some platforms offer demo versions of their most popular titles, which can be played in a simulated environment.
- Free spins : Users may receive free spins on specific slots or participate in tournaments without depositing any money.
- Virtual currency : Some spin casinos use virtual tokens as an alternative to real-money bets.
Real Money vs Free Play Differences
While both options share many similarities, there are significant differences between playing with real money and using demo modes or non-monetary alternatives:
- Risk management : Real money games involve financial risk, while free play reduces the stakes.
- Game availability : Some titles may not be available in demo mode or for free play due to licensing restrictions.
- User experience : Real-money games often offer a more immersive and engaging user experience.
